The five companies include China United Airlines Co., Ltd., Shanghai Airlines Cargo International Co., Ltd., Shanghai-Airlines Cargo International Transportation Services Co., Ltd., Shanghai Crane Transportation Co., Ltd. and Dahang International Transportation Co., Ltd. each of the six members is independent in assets and shares advantages with others.
The alliance has nearly 70 passenger liners and cargo liners of Boeing or Bombardier including three MD-11 all-cargo carrier, two Boeing 757 all-cargo carriers and one Boeing 747 all-cargo carrier. It launches over 170 domestic flights and nearly 20 international flights to more than 60 large-and medium-sized cities in China and other countries.
The alliance will absorb other companies in the industry, reveals Xu Junmin, secretary to the board of directors of the listed company, in an interview.
